油炸小可爱|接住我的下巴,架构师社区极力推崇的“架构师进阶指南”也太赞了

前言经常看到开发了两三年小伙伴说 , 自己除了基本的CURD什么都不会 , 对于系统如何去设计和迭代完全没有概念 。 在这个技术不断迭代更新的时代这样肯定是不行的 , 我们做开发的除CURD外更应该关注的系统架构和编程之道 。 要能够快速从编写业务代码进阶到更高的阶段 。 那么如何搭建一个好的开放平台?怎么才算是好的平台?
其实现阶段做一个好的开放平台主要有三方面的挑战

  • 稳定性
每天数十亿的请求 , 有的来自商家、有的来自外部开发者 , 还有的来自外部合作伙伴平台 , API请求的类型除了简单的Key-Value读写 , 还有多维度的写数据请求和复杂查询 。
  • 开发者体验
这里的开发者包括提供API的开发者及使用API的开发者 , 对于开发者的体验大家往往会忽略 , 但他们是开放平台的真实客户 , 决定开放平台的发展和未来 。
  • 安全
这是一个最大的挑战 。 电商的数据是多维度的 , 包括商品管理、订单生产、售后客服处理、财务结算及各种营销管理 , 等等 , 基本每个场景都会涉及数据处理和授权 。
要确保能解决这三个挑战 , 自身所需要掌握的知识无疑是很庞大的 。
如果你不想局限于CURD , 想开始自己做系统架构 , 想从编写业务代码进阶到更高的阶段 , 那么下面介绍的这份文档肯定会对你起到一定帮助 。 想提升自己的架构设计能力 , 不仅需要系统的理论知识 , 更需要大量的工作实践 。 这份文档就以实际场景为主题 , 逐步深入阐述架构知识 , 以点到面契入架构之道 。
【油炸小可爱|接住我的下巴,架构师社区极力推崇的“架构师进阶指南”也太赞了】这份文档由亿级网关、平台开放、分布式、微服务、容错等核心技术展开 , 需要这份架构学习文档 , 关注我主持一下然后私信“架构”二字即可免费获取
API网关
  • 认识API网关
  • 一个API的生命周期
  • API网关的基石一泛化调用
  • 如何发布API到网关系统
  • 管道技术
  • 一个传统网关系统有几种死法
  • Servlet3异步原理与实践
  • 全异步网关
  • 脱库与多级缓存
  • 热更新
  • 网关系统的七种武器
讲述网关的前世今生 , 以及一个成熟的网关应该具备的能力 。
油炸小可爱|接住我的下巴,架构师社区极力推崇的“架构师进阶指南”也太赞了OAuth2.0
  • 认识OAuth2
  • 开放平台
  • 如何设计一套SPI应用架构
  • 讲一讲越权
  • 从Facebook数据泄漏谈开放安全
  • API治理
  • API经济
  • 沙箱环境
在网关的基础上围绕API展开介绍
油炸小可爱|接住我的下巴,架构师社区极力推崇的“架构师进阶指南”也太赞了分布式
  • 认识分布式
  • 分布式事务
  • 分布式锁
  • 分布式限流
  • 衡量性能的指标QPS. TPS等
重点介绍常见的事务、锁、限流场景下的知识
油炸小可爱|接住我的下巴,架构师社区极力推崇的“架构师进阶指南”也太赞了
油炸小可爱|接住我的下巴,架构师社区极力推崇的“架构师进阶指南”也太赞了MQ
  • 认识JMS
  • 带着思考理解MQ下的基本概念
  • 消费哥等
  • 详述MQ各种功能场景
  • 数据异构的武器--MQ+canal
  • 关于MQ再问自己几个问题
从基础一直介绍到MQ的常用功能场景
油炸小可爱|接住我的下巴,架构师社区极力推崇的“架构师进阶指南”也太赞了


推荐阅读